Compare all specifications:
1984 De Tomaso Longchamp | 1985 Lincoln Continental | |
Make | De Tomaso | Lincoln |
Model | Longchamp | Continental |
Year Released | 1984 | 1985 |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 5763 cc | 4942 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 8 cylinders | 8 cylinders |
Engine Type | V | in-line |
Horse Power | 296 HP | 138 HP |
Engine RPM | 6000 RPM | 3200 RPM |
Torque | 450 Nm | 338 Nm |
Torque RPM | 3500 RPM | 1600 RPM |
Fuel Type | Gasoline | Gasoline |
Drive Type | Rear | Rear |
Number of Seats | 5 seats | 5 seats |
Vehicle Weight | 1700 kg | 1700 kg |
Vehicle Length | 4540 mm | 5120 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1840 mm | 1880 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1300 mm | 1400 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2610 mm | 2760 mm |
